Cost to run a chest freezer in Kentucky (June 2026 rates)
At 14.26¢ per kilowatt-hour — Kentucky's average residential price in June 2026 — running a chest freezer costs $42.78 a year. That is 22% less than the national average of $55.02. Kentucky's residential rate is up 6.4% from June 2025, which moves this appliance from $40.20 to $42.78 a year.
- Per day
- 11.7¢
- Per month
- $3.56
- Per year
- $42.78
Assumption: 300 kWh a year. A 7 cubic-foot manual-defrost chest freezer. Upright frost-free models run considerably higher. Use the calculator to swap in the numbers from your own model.

Cutting the number down
- A full freezer holds its temperature through each door opening better than an empty one. Jugs of water are free thermal mass.
- Manual-defrost models use less energy than frost-free ones, at the cost of an annual chore.
- Keeping it somewhere cool matters: an unconditioned garage in summer raises the running cost all season.
